Churchill Downs
Churchill Downs
Hallowed home of the Kentucky Derby, Churchill Downs is pure Louisville. Big tradition, big atmosphere, and plenty of Derby-day energy, even on non-Derby days. It’s also where we’ll end the week with the InstructureCon closing night party, so wear something fun and come ready to celebrate.
